@spences10/pi-context

Keep huge tool output useful without flooding the model context.
pi-context stores oversized command, file, MCP, and LSP results in a
local searchable SQLite sidecar, then gives the agent compact receipts
it can search or retrieve when needed.
In a SvelteKit docs extraction benchmark against the published
full-chunk retrieval flow, snippet-first search plus focused retrieval
and file export reduced total tokens by 68%, cache-read tokens by
70%, and cost by 54% while producing a comparable answer. See
docs/pi-context-benchmark.md
for the scenario and raw comparison.
| Metric | Published | Current flow | Reduction |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tool calls | 49 | 27 | 45% |
| Context tool chars returned | 438,655 | 181,417 | 59% |
| Total tool chars returned | 488,258 | 196,530 | 60% |
| Input tokens | 163,626 | 116,844 | 29% |
| Cache-read tokens | 2,943,488 | 884,224 | 70% |
| Total tokens | 3,113,785 | 1,004,674 | 68% |
| Cost | $2.49 | $1.13 | 54% |
This is an ephemeral overflow cache for large artifacts, not durable
session memory. Use pirecall for durable session history.
Runtime
Requires Node.js >=24.15.0 for native node:sqlite plus FTS5. The
my-pi CLI suppresses Node's expected node:sqlite
ExperimentalWarning; standalone package consumers own their process
warning policy until Node marks node:sqlite stable.

Receipts include the source id, first exact chunk id, and a low-context retrieval path:
First chunk id: ctx_..._0001
context_search query:"..." source_id:"ctx_..."
context_get source_id:"ctx_..." chunk_id:"ctx_..._0001" before:1 after:1
context_export source_id:"ctx_..."
context_list
context_get accepts exact chunk ids plus ordinal aliases such as 1
or 0001, and legacy guessed references such as ctx_...:chunk:000.
Use before / after with chunk_id to include neighboring chunks
in one call. Neighbor ranges are capped at 3 chunks each side to avoid
accidentally recreating full-source retrieval. context_export
accepts the same source/chunk selectors and neighbor options. By
default it writes to
${PI_CODING_AGENT_DIR:-~/.pi/agent}/context-exports/, next to the
sidecar database, and cleans that managed export directory using the
same retention-days policy as the sidecar. Pass file_path to write
elsewhere; relative paths resolve from the current working directory.
The tool returns only export metadata.
Coverage policy
Intentional sidecar-backed output:
readandbashtext output: handled by the generictool_resulthook when output exceeds byte/line thresholds.- MCP tool output: handled directly in
@spences10/pi-mcpbefore temp-file fallback, then ignored by the generic hook because receipts already contain[context-sidecar]. - LSP tool output: handled by the generic hook for large text diagnostics or symbol/reference dumps; small structured summaries stay inline.
- Hook output and telemetry summaries: not directly indexed unless they appear as large text tool results.
Intentionally skipped output:
context_*tools: avoids recursive indexing of retrieval/maintenance output.team: coordination/mailbox/task state belongs in team-mode and session history surfaces, not this overflow cache.- Non-text/image results: ignored by
pi-context; image/file handling should use dedicated tool-specific surfaces.
Any newly sidecar-backed text follows the same redaction, project/session scope, retention, and dedupe rules.
Storage, scoping, and retention
The default DB path is
${PI_CODING_AGENT_DIR:-~/.pi/agent}/context.db. Set
MY_PI_CONTEXT_DB to override it.
Default context_export files are written next to that database under
context-exports/, for example
${PI_CODING_AGENT_DIR:-~/.pi/agent}/context-exports/ctx_....txt.
Older managed export files are pruned on export using the same
retention-days setting as the sidecar.
New sources are scoped by Pi session file/id when available, falling
back to the current project path. Retrieval tools use that scope by
default to avoid leaking other projects or sessions into results; pass
global: true when you intend to search or list everything.
Retention, storage cap, and capture thresholds are saved at
~/.config/my-pi/context.json via /context settings. Presets
include default, light, balanced, research, and archive;
custom values are available with:
/context settings custom <days|off> <max-mb|off> [capture-kb] [capture-lines] [purge-on-shutdown]
Capture thresholds control when large tool output is moved into the
sidecar instead of staying inline in the model context. Defaults match
historical behavior: generic tools capture after 24 KiB or 300
lines; MCP output captures after 50 KiB or 2000 lines.
Environment variables override saved settings:
MY_PI_CONTEXT_RETENTION_DAYS— default7; set0,off, ordisabledto disable age cleanup.MY_PI_CONTEXT_PURGE_ON_SHUTDOWN— settrue/1/yes/onto run cleanup on shutdown.MY_PI_CONTEXT_MAX_MB— optional max stored raw bytes; oldest sources are removed first when exceeded.MY_PI_CONTEXT_CAPTURE_MAX_KB/MY_PI_CONTEXT_CAPTURE_MAX_LINES— generic tool-output capture threshold.MY_PI_CONTEXT_MCP_MAX_KB/MY_PI_CONTEXT_MCP_MAX_LINES— MCP output capture threshold.MY_PI_CONTEXT_CONFIG— override the saved settings file path.
Safety model
This is redacted local persistence and retrieval, not a security
sandbox. Stored text is redacted with @spences10/pi-redact before
persistence, but anything persisted in the local SQLite DB should
still be treated as local tool output.
